Broken window replacement services involve removing damaged or shattered glass from a window frame and installing a new, clear pane in its place. This process typically includes carefully removing the broken glass, cleaning the frame, and fitting a new window pane to ensure proper sealing and appearance. Skilled service providers can handle various types of windows, including single-pane, double-pane, or specialty glass, to restore the functionality and appearance of a property’s windows.

This service helps address a range of problems caused by broken or damaged windows. Common issues include safety hazards from jagged glass shards, increased energy costs due to poor insulation, and compromised security of the property. Broken windows can also lead to drafts, water leaks, and further damage if not repaired promptly. Timely replacement can improve safety, prevent additional property damage, and restore the aesthetic appeal of a home or commercial building.

The overview below groups typical Broken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Helena, MT.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For minor cracks or broken panes,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Most routine repairs fall within this range, depending on glass size and type.

Standard Window Replacement - Replacing a standard-sized window usually costs between $600 and $1,200. Many projects in Helena and nearby areas are priced in this middle range, with fewer reaching higher costs.

Larger or Custom Windows - Larger or custom-designed window replacements can range from $1,200 to $3,000 or more. These jobs are less common but may be necessary for unique or historic properties.

Full Property Window Overhaul - Complete window replacement for an entire home or commercial building can cost $10,000+ depending on the number of windows and complexity. These larger projects are less frequent but handled by local service providers for extensive upgrades.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
